§ 38.201 — TEXAS ELECTRICITY SUPPLY CHAIN SECURITY AND MAPPING COMMITTEE
UT § 38.201Title 2. PUBLIC UTILITY REGULATORY ACT · Part B. ELECTRIC UTILITIES · Ch. 38. REGULATION OF ELECTRIC SERVICES · Art. F. TEXAS ELECTRICITY SUPPLY CHAIN SECURITY AND MAPPING COMMITTEE
Statute text
View on source(a)In this subchapter, "electricity supply chain" means:
(1)facilities and methods used for producing, treating, processing, pressurizing, storing, or transporting natural gas for delivery to electric generation facilities;
(2)critical infrastructure necessary to maintain electricity service; and
(3)roads necessary to access facilities in the electricity supply chain. (a-1) A reference in this subchapter to the "electricity supply chain" includes water and wastewater treatment plants.
(b)The Texas Electricity Supply Chain Security and Mapping Committee is established to:
(1)map this state's electricity supply chain;
